Output af3ad075c3d81b332d37c8ec36c199694c60ed911ea18b1d028a36386d4a15c6:3

value
454390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a322b9899de21d4a7b75768fe2ccebb22e8a6d OP_EQUAL
address
39Dxm8uP8kLTVkUs8Qy73mxCUdzBe4v1DL
transaction
af3ad075c3d81b332d37c8ec36c199694c60ed911ea18b1d028a36386d4a15c6
spent
true